Mission Statement and Site History

PowerBook Central went live in December, 1996 as a little-known website called PowerBook Classified Advertising, hosted on America Online. The founder, Steve Hildreth, began the site in frustration over the chaos of ads in newsgroups. Coded on a PowerBook 165c, PowerBook Classified Advertising grew in popularity and soon had hundreds of ads. During the following year, other features were added to the site, including a buyer's guide and specifications.

In the Spring of 1998, PowerBook Classified Advertising changed its name to PowerBook Central to reflect its broadening content. At the same time, PowerBook Central moved from AOL to a dedicated server with its own domain. Soon after, PowerBook Central added many new features to become more competitive in the marketplace, including a new classified ad system. During this time period, PowerBook Central was coded on a PowerBook 1400c/233MHz G3.

In 1999, PowerBook Central began tracking PowerBook prices from all the major Apple Authorized Resellers. This soon grew in popularity, and the price trackers began receiving nearly as much traffic as the classified ads. During this time period, PowerBook Central was coded on a 1999 Lombard PowerBook G3/400.

PowerBook Central was coded on a 17" PowerBook from when they were introduced to 2006. In 2006, PowerBook Central changed its name to Power'Book Central and shortened its domain to PBCentral.com. Why PB? PB is short for PowerBook, and many readers referred to our site as pbcentral anyhow.
